Automatically hide/unhide rows
I'm a VBA newbie and have searched for an answer for how to do this, but must
be doing something wrong when I've tried other codes. I need to have rows automatically hide or unhide based on a value in column D. If the value in column D is Y, the row should not be hidden; if the value is N, the row should be hidden. These values may change, so the rows need to be able to hide/unhide automatically. When I've entered codes in before, I click on the tab for this worksheet, select View Code, choose Insert Module, and then insert the code. There is already a code in this worksheet for something else, so I can't just add it in after selecting View Code. Am I putting the code in the wrong spot? Should I be choosing something else other than Insert Module? I've tried out so many different codes thinking that was the problem, but now I think I may just be entering it wrong. I appreciate your help. |
